DESCRIPTION:The aim of this course is to familiarize the participants with 
 the primary analysis of datasets generated through two popular high-throug
 hput sequencing (HTS) assays: ChIP-seq and RNA-seq. \n\nThis course starts
  with a brief introduction to the transition from capillary to high-throug
 hput sequencing (HTS) and discusses quality control issues\, which are com
 mon among all HTS datasets. Next\, we will present the alignment step and 
 how it differs between the two analysis workflows. Finally\, we focus on d
 ataset specific downstream analysis\, including peak calling and motif ana
 lysis for ChIP-seq and quantification of expression\, transcriptome assemb
 ly and differential expression analysis for RNA-seq. \n\nPlease note that
